I bought a LED closet/drawer lite from Walmart that has a magnet mount & uses 3 AAA batteries( push on, push off).

To mount it in the trunk,I picked up a large fender washer at the hardware store @ used silicone glue to mount the washer to the inside top of the trunk giving the lite magnet something to attach to,works pretty good & gives off almost as much lite as the trunk lite I got from Roadsmith & I don't have to turn the key on.

Had the same issue when unpacking the trunk. The missus couldnt see at night. So being frugal as I am I went to the dollar store and bought some of those small circular multi LED press lights. Found a good spot on the lid where it would shine down with the lid open and then put some 3M double stick tape on the back and mounted one. Been there 4 years and still working. With a spoiler ,luggage rack, and brake flasher, and lighted trunk handle, I didnt feel like opening the inner trunk lid to wire one more accessory and if the light should break its easily replaced.
